Saturday 4 November 2006

101 Talbot

101 Talbot
Upstairs
100-102 Talbot Street
Dublin 1

Participants: F, R, U, J


Rating
  • Food: 4.4/6
  • Drink: 3.8/6
  • Toilet: 4.8/6
  • Ambience: 3.7/6

Food
"I had the homemade Pork and Apple sausage (apple was a bit lost), skillfully combined with red onions. (...) Really good food, amazing value (2 courses, 21,50€)."
"Unusually sophisticated vegetarian food, most restaurants lack the necessary inspiration, when it comes to vegetarian food; here they really put some effort into it."
"Chef doesn't seem to use salt."
Risotto pumpkin and goat cheese: "Again, tasty, but no salt. NOT HOT ENOUGH. Interesting flavour combination (pumpkin, spring onion, subtle goat cheese)."
Pear poached in red wine, with home made cookies: "incredibly delicious, wonderful!"
Drink
"Beer too warm, coffee non-descript."
Toilet
"Three stalls, soap dispenser working - and even flushing was possible!"
Ambience
"Very friendly + lively place, nice service. A bit noisy and crowded, but for our group of 4 it's great."
"Nice warm light, but really noisy."
"The greasy, dirty fan at the ceiling was a bit disgusting."
